ENVIRONMENT: 2002 the Planet’s Second Warmest Year

Gustavo Capdevila

GENEVA, Dec 18 2002 (IPS) - This year, which saw an increase in the Earth’s average surface temperature, is the second warmest in the 160 years since instrumental measurements of temperatures have been recorded, reports the World Meteorological Organisation (WMO).

Another notable weather trait of 2002 is the reappearance of the phenomenon known as El Niño, though in a more moderate version than its most recent occurrence, in 1997-1998.

Since 1900, the planet’s average surface temperature has risen 0.6 degrees Celsius, and the temperatures recorded this year, through late November, were a half-degree higher than the annual average from 1961 to 1990.

As a result, 2002 replaced 2001 as being the second hottest year – after 1998 – of the 20th century.

The exceptional readings on thermometers in the last few years are not isolated incidents. "Clearly, for the past 25 or 26 years, the warming has been accelerating," said WMO Climate Programme director Kenneth Davidson, adding that the rate of increase "is unprecedented in the last thousand years."

This warming has been verified through ice core samples, seabed samples and tree ring samples, Davidson explained.

The rate of warming is the most noteworthy aspect of the phenomenon. Davidson admitted that he is surprised at the rate of temperature increases.

"Personally, I would say it isn’t what I expected," he told a press conference as he presented the WMO report Tuesday. "I think that everyone is surprised to see this rate of increase" in the average world temperatures.

The phenomenon is being tracked by the Intergovernmental Panel on Climate Change (IPCC), which is made up of scientists specialising in studying aspects related to global warming.

In its the third assessment report, the IPCC states that the world is warming at unprecedented rates and it is "likely" that human activities are influencing this phenomenon.

"And I would say that certainly is the opinion of the members of the WMO as well," the United Nations agency entrusted with research and information on climate phenomenon, said Davidson.

The warming trend will persist unless additional steps are taken to curb greenhouse gas emissions, which contribute to retaining heat in the Earth’s atmosphere, according to WMO assistant secretary-general Hong Yan.

The WMO annual report, which Yan presented Tuesday in Geneva, notes the reappearance in 2002 of conditions in the tropical Pacific that are known to give rise to El Niño.

The El Niño event occurs every three to seven years, when the sea-surface temperature over a large area of the equatorial Pacific, off Australia, becomes warmer than normal, and this current of warmer water moves eastwards, towards South America.

The presence of the current alters the winds and the climate in general, and can cause weather extremes, including torrential rains and drought, in the Pacific region.

Climatologists explain that El Niño is only one stage of a characteristic cycle of changes that occur in this region, and can be likened to a pendulum. An El Niño event occurs when the pendulum reaches its maximum point.

The two relatively recent El Niño experiences that are considered the most intense in history occurred in 1982-1983 and 1997-1998, causing the extremes of drought and flooding, with devastating consequences for humans and for economies.

But Davidson said, "We are anticipating that the El Niño conditions will begin to move back to neutral after next May."

The WMO also called attention to the reduced size of the so- called ozone hole over Antarctica. The Southern Hemisphere spring is when the atmospheric ozone layer thins, but this year the total area of the hole was the smallest since 1988.

In late September, an unprecedented event occurred: the ozone hole cleaved into two parts. The hole expanded until mid-October, but by early November it had disappeared. The thinning is cyclical, occurring from September to as late as December.

The limited area of the hole and the brevity of its appearance can be explained by meteorological conditions in the stratosphere, says the WMO. Efforts must continue to eliminate the production and use of ozone-depleting gases, particularly CFCs and furans.

The UN agency’s report also states that the extent of sea ice covering the Arctic Ocean in September this year was less than in any previous September since 1978, when satellite observations began to be conducted.
